He has fallen into line with everything Joe has said and it’s becoming increasingly uncomfortable to watch. But surely the Graham we know, the Graham who was trained in the SAS and has spent the last six years ‘fixing’ problems the police couldn’t, wouldn’t just bow down to Joe and do everything he asked? So what is going on here? Does Graham have a master plan – and should Joe be worried? Joe told Graham he should have stayed dead (Credit: ITV) Joe treats Graham like dirt in Emmerdale Joe does have a history of treating people as he pleases and still getting what he wants. And ever since Graham returned from the dead, Joe has been pretty harsh on him. Understandable, maybe, but what’s not clear is exactly why Graham is sucking it up. Earlier this month Graham expressed his disapproval over how Joe destroyed Robert and Victoria for financial gain. Joe told him: “You better fall in line. If you want to be on my team, Graham, you will play by my rules.” Graham simply nodded his head in agreement. article continues below Read all the latest spoilers This week Graham has been on Joe’s mission to ‘destroy Cain’. But when he went to Butlers to get back the keys to the DeLorean, Graham discovered Cain had cancer. Since then he’s been trying to help Cain while also seeming to Joe like he was still Team Tate. However Kim has grown suspicious and urged Joe to test Graham. Joe did just that, over some farm machinery, and it turned out Graham was helping Cain and lying to Joe. Now Joe isn’t very happy and has told Graham he should have “stayed dead”. Ouch.Don't miss a single story! Graham takes everything Joe says without fighting back (Credit: ITV) So what is really going on with Graham in Emmerdale? Once again Graham just took Joe’s harsh words and apologised. But is all this easily explained by Graham’s guilt over leaving Joe all those years ago? Or is there more to it? We are pretty sure there is far more to it – and so are plenty of fans… Graham was working for somebody when he returned (Credit: ITV) 1. Graham working for the police in Emmerdale? When he returned we discovered Graham had been working for the police a lot, ‘fixing’ problems they couldn’t solve. And fans are convinced that’s why he’s really back and his involvement with force is on-going… “Working with, but not for the police,” one suggested on social media. Another referenced his connection to Coronation Street’s Jodie. They said: “Tonight Jodie told someone she was in witness protection so is [Graham] working for the police? Don’t forget a top police officer took part in covering his death so he could be in her pocket.” “Working with the police to bring Joe and Kim down,” added a third. Joe and Kim were blindsided by Graham’s Emmerdale return (Credit: ITV) 2. To bring Kim and Joe’s empire crashing down Speaking of which, whether he’s working with the police or not, many viewers are convinced he is here to bring the Tates down. So does Graham have revenge in mind? “Yes, I’m hoping Graham (as much as he cares about Joe) has come back to get his revenge on them both and it would be satisfying to wipe Joe’s smug smile off his face. Really not liking Kim right now,” shared one. A second added: “I’m hoping he teams up with Robert and Aaron to bring down the Tates.” “He wants to bring Kim down…after all she did put a hit on him…” mused a third. “A complex plot maybe. Graham and Joe pretending there’s friction between them but it’s all an elaborate act to overthrow Kim…” a fourth suggested. Was Joe Celia’s boss? (Credit: ITV) 3. Is Joe the real criminal mastermind? Rumours that the end is nigh for Joe Tate just won’t go away and fans think they know why – and why Graham is behind it all. “I reckon Joe is the big boss of Celia etc and Graham is working undercover to bring him down,” suggested one viewer. Another agreed: “I think Joe is behind all the bad stuff going on in Emmerdale. Maybe one of his victims has a conection to Graham?” “Think Graham might be working under cover to catch the gang and drug smugglers and Joe could have something to do with it,” added a third. A fourth thought Graham and Kim’s hatred was all an act: “I am thinking is Graham working with Kim to flush out Joe,” they said. “No way would Kim want Moira in prison and farm taken off her which makes Joe the lord of that Ray and vile mother of his.” Graham certaily has the swagger of someone in charge (Credit: ITV) 4. Or is Graham in charge? Some think Graham is not as good as he’s cracked up to be. One suggested Graham is the one in charge… “Graham could control the power across the board,” they said. “He already knows Joe hates what he did and Joe’s just using him. Kim’s picking the wrong enemy, one that was trained by the state so bring it on Graham.” Are Graham and Joe related? (Credit: ITV) 5. Joe’s real dad? A slightly out-there theory, but one that isn’t going away, none-the-less: is Graham Joe Tate’s real dad? Viewers know Chris Tate and Rachel Hughes are Joe’s parents. Graham was not even known of back when Joe was born. But could the soap be about to rewrite history? “Father possibly????” and “Could he be Joe’s dad?” queried several fans. Another added: “I think Joe is Graham’s son.” Whatever the outcome, it had better be good – because Graham needs to stop playing the lapdog and start being the leader he was born to be or else his return was pointless.
